If anyone could spend a few minutes reviewing my choices for my first freenas build:

Mobo Asrock C2550D4I

Case fractal design 804

Memory 2x Crucial CT102472BD160B.18FED

PSU Corsar 450 RM modular PSU

USB 8gb for boot, 1SSD for mysql

Storage 6x2TB Green WD - already owned

Cache (l2arc?) 1x SSD 120 OWC - already owned

ZIL 1x SSD Toshiba THNSNJ128GCSU - already owned

Is this build ok? Would use for a few vms + backup + transmission.

What would you change?

Thanks in advance:)

You really didn't need a ZIL or a L2ARC with a system this size. I'd consider getting one more USB drive and do a mirror boot device and maybe bump them up to 16GB if you don't what to prune old boot environments much.

so, 2x16 usb drives to boot? like raid1?

i never used freebsd/freenas but on linux i don´t think you can do that via sw, i need a hw raid for the boot device. (i think)

doesnt zil/l2arc help for the iops for the vmware?

If you have both of the USB drives installed at the time you install FreeNAS it will ask you about mirroring them then. If not, you can add it through the GUI later. FreeNAS uses ZFS to software mirror the two USB drives. So, you get all the benefits of ZFS on the boot drives. Scrubs, error detection, etc.
